Obituary

It is with great sadness to announce that on August 17th, Frank Mahlon Vibbert passed away at 82 years old surrounded by loving family members.

Frank was a man who was passionate about making his community a better place. He touched many peoples’ lives along the way through his enthusiasm for service, honesty and giving back.

In his professional community, Frank spent over four decades in Civil Engineering and Geotechnical engineering, with most of this time serving as Branch Manager for Schnabel Foundation Company. He played a significant role in the design of many complex, large-scale construction projects. Through his career, he became recognized as an industry-leader in implementing revolutionary new geotechnical design principles that today have become standard procedures which enable large-scale construction projects to proceed faster, more safely and more cost-effectively.

In his personal community, he enthusiastically gave his time and energy to the congregation of the Lower Providence Presbyterian Church which contributed to making this a loving and caring community for so many families over the years.

Outside the church, Frank also consistently volunteered his time in the Audubon, PA community with a myriad different organizations including Boy Scouts, youth sports, and the Methacton School District.

Frank’s reputation for integrity was unquestioned. His opinion was respected, not only because of his intelligence and experience, but also because you knew you were getting an unselfish, honest opinion that was not affected by popular opinion or what people wanted to hear.

Frank was also an adored father and husband. He wanted nothing more than to make his family happy, and he worked tirelessly every day to do this.

Frank was born on February 16, 1944 in Hagerstown, MD to parents Betty Vibbert and Charles Vibbert. He graduated from Palmyra High School and then studied Civil Engineering at University of Delaware where he graduated in 1967. He received a Masters of Science in Civil Engineering from Villanova University.

He is survived by his wife, Nancy, his children Brian (Beth) Vibbert, Don (Susan) Vibbert, and Jen (Brian) Berbary as well as his grandchildren: Sarah, Mikey, Audrey, Kimmy, and Megan, as well as his brother Bill (Diane) Vibbert. Frank was preceded in death by his parents, Charles and Betty Vibbert, and his brother Bruce (Faye) Vibbert.
